How Nigerian Army Soldiers Foiled a Boko Haram Suicide Plot in Gwoza

0 Admin

 

A potentially devastating suicide attack in Gwoza Local Government Area of Borno State was averted in the early days of the new year after troops of Operation HADIN KAI neutralised three Boko Haram suicide bombers in a swift, intelligence-led operation.

The incident occurred along the Guduf–Pulka corridor, a volatile stretch linking several communities in southern Borno. Acting on actionable intelligence, troops moved decisively, working closely with local vigilante and volunteer forces whose familiarity with the terrain proved critical to the success of the mission. The collaboration once again highlighted the growing importance of community participation in counter-terrorism efforts in the North-East.

Confirming the development, the Media Information Officer of Operation HADIN KAI, Lieutenant Colonel Sani Uba, said the suicide bombers were intercepted before they could reach their intended targets, thereby preventing what could have resulted in mass civilian casualties.

According to him, the terrorists were neutralised during a deliberate operation carefully designed to disrupt their movement and neutralise the threat. In the aftermath, troops recovered suicide vests and other components of improvised explosive devices (IEDs), which were immediately secured to eliminate further risk to residents of the area.

The operation did not end there. Troops also engaged the terrorist escorts accompanying the bombers, killing several of them and forcing others to flee into the rugged Mandara Mountains. During exploitation of the area, four AK-47 rifles were recovered, while two motorcycles used by the terrorists were destroyed.

Military intelligence later revealed that the suicide bombers were dispatched by the Ali Ngulde–led Jama’atu Ahlis Sunna Lidda’awati wal-Jihad (JAS) faction of Boko Haram, operating from the Mandara Mountain axis along the Nigeria–Cameroon border.

In response, Operation HADIN KAI has intensified offensive operations in the area, aimed at dismantling remaining terrorist cells and cutting off suicide-bomber supply chains. The military has also strengthened cooperation with other security agencies as well as community groups across Borno and neighbouring Yobe State to safeguard vulnerable locations.

Reaffirming the military’s resolve, Lt. Col. Uba assured that Operation HADIN KAI remains committed to sustaining pressure on terrorist elements and ensuring the safety and security of civilians across the North-East.
